Pipe Drainage and Agricultural Progress: Hew Dalrymple’s Clay-Pipe Revolution
In the long story of Scottish innovation, some of the most transformative ideas were not dramatic machines or grand engines, but practical improvements that quietly reshaped everyday life. One such development was pipe drainage, pioneered and promoted in Scotland by Hew Dalrymple, whose use of clay pipes to drain waterlogged fields played a crucial role in improving agricultural productivity during the late eighteenth and early nineteenth centuries.
The Problem of Waterlogged Land
Much of Scotland’s farmland suffered from poor natural drainage. Heavy rainfall, clay soils, and low-lying ground often left fields saturated for long periods, delaying sowing, reducing yields, and limiting the types of crops that could be grown. Traditional open ditches helped to some extent, but they wasted valuable land, required constant maintenance, and were often inefficient.
Hew Dalrymple and a New Approach
Hew Dalrymple, a Scottish agricultural improver, recognised that better drainage was essential if farming was to advance. Drawing on practical experimentation and observation, he promoted the use of buried clay pipes laid beneath the soil to carry excess water away from fields. Unlike open drains, these pipes allowed water to be removed without taking land out of production.
The clay pipes were relatively simple—cylindrical sections made from fired clay—but their impact was profound. When laid in networks below the surface, they lowered the water table, dried the soil, and created better conditions for plant roots.
Transforming Scottish Agriculture
Pipe drainage dramatically improved soil structure and fertility. Fields that had once been cold, wet, and unproductive became workable earlier in the year and remained usable for longer into the season. Farmers saw increases in crop yields, better pasture for livestock, and greater reliability in their harvests.
The success of Dalrymple’s methods encouraged wider adoption across Scotland and beyond. As pipe-making became more standardised and affordable, drainage systems spread rapidly during the agricultural improvements of the nineteenth century.
